Some poker websites also use software programs that allow them to save, sort, and recall hand histories. These tools are useful for analyzing and comparing your own results with those of other players. They can also be used to scan for players with particular patterns and display them next to their names in a heads-up display (HUD).

Professional poker players often use these tools to analyze and improve their game. They can also create hand histories from hands they’ve played and use odds, equity or variance calculators to help them decide which bets are best based on their cards.
